About Quorum Software
Quorum Software connects people and information across the energy value chain. Twenty years ago, we built the first software for gas plant accountants. Pipeline operators came next, followed by land administrators, pumpers, and planners. Since 1998, Quorum has helped thousands of energy workers with business workflows that optimize profitability and growth. Our vision for the future connects the global energy ecosystem through cloud-first software, data standards, and integration. The trusted source of decision-ready data for 1,800+ companies, Quorum Software makes the essential connections that let us work better together in the connected energy workplace. What You Will Do:
- Manage end-to-end Upgrades around Hydrocarbon accounting using Energy Components product.
- Perform task independently and holds ownership.
- coordinate with cross-functional teams to align on project deliverables and timelines.
- Balance workload priorities across multiple concurrent upgrades and deliverables for various customers
- Oversee improvements to documentation around upgrade activities
- Oversee team implementation of standard best practices and identify possible improvements to technical processes & team workflow
- Understand, follow, and broadcast process changes to team members
- And other duties as assigned.
What To Bring:
- Candidate must possess at least a bachelor’s degree, Post Graduate Diploma, Professional Deg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Mathematics or equivalent.
- At least 1 year of working experience in delivering Energy Components Solutions is required for this position.
- Working on Energy components upgrade projects is an advantage.
- Good technical skills in software technologies such as Java, Oracle PL/SQL within Linux and Windows environment
- Good technical experience in diagnosing, troubleshooting, solving code errors, and fixing bug issues.
- Experienced in Cloud Infrastructure services (i.e., AWS and Azure) would be added advantage
- Good analytical, problem-solving skills to resolve issues as well as providing short-term and long-term solutions
- Candidates with experience in Oil and Gas industry and/or hydrocarbon accounting are encouraged to apply
- Proficient in communicating to stakeholders in English.
- A team player and enjoy working in a multi-cultural environment
